Another body snatcher

I saw this on the beach. It flew onto my sun lounger and I was able to get a quick snap of it with my phone before it flew off again. I've yet to identify this wasp but it was approximately 10mm in length. I was initially thinking it was perhaps Euodynerus megaera however I think it is too small for this species. I'm guessing it's a potter wasp of some kind. The hunt continues!
